Semi-supervised Graph Anomaly Detection Via Multi-view Contrastive Learning
Hengji Dong,Jing Zhao,Hongwei Yang,Hui He,Jun Zhou,Yunqing Feng,Yangyiye Jin,Rui Liu,Mengge Wang
DOI: https://doi.org/10.1109/ijcnn60899.2024.10650001
2024-01-01
Abstract:Graph anomaly detection aims to identify the abnormal nodes in a graph that deviate from the majority of nodes, which is critical in fields such as finance and social network analysis. Due to the unbearable costs of labeling anomalies, existing methods are mainly tackled from unsupervised or semi-supervised manners. Unfortunately, most proposed methods either lack prior knowledge of the anomalies or neglect the potential relation between labeled and unlabeled nodes, with limited improvement. In this paper, we propose a novel Semi-supervised learning framework for graph Anomaly Detection via Multi-view Contrastive Learning (SADMCL for abbreviation), which uses very few labels to promote detection performance. To be specific, we employ multi-view contrastive learning, i.e., sample-sample contrast, sample-instance contrast, and normal-anomaly contrast, to generate the representations with significant discrimination between normal and abnormal nodes, as well as the instances that respond to the normal features. By comparing the learned representations and the instances, we comprehensively calculate the anomaly score for each node and infer its label. Extensive experiments conducted on four real-world datasets demonstrate that our approach outperforms current state-of-the-art anomaly detection algorithms when provided with few labeled samples.